A high-net-worth gentleman based in Seattle, Washington is looking for a live-in House Manager who would ensure the smooth running of his household and also act as his Personal Cook.
The gentleman has a small dog so the house manager has to be dog-friendly and assist with pet care when needed.
The client lives in a large house but he doesn't have other full-time staff, there are only part-time cleaners that come once a week and part-time gardeners (contractors).
This is a long-term full-time position starting in May-June 2023.

Vacancy duties and responsibilities
- Represent the client in a professional, discreet manner at all times
- Keep the client's schedule and maintain calendars, attending to his specific needs as directed
- Event Planning – Coordinate and facilitate events by working closely with the Principal and outside vendors to ensure everything goes smoothly
- Hire, train, and supervise additional support staff in the home if needed
- Manage part-time cleaning staff to ensure the entire home is cleaned on a zoned rotating basis and guest-ready at all times
- Schedule appointments, arrange meetings and other engagements
- Organize closets, storage spaces, home office
- Run errands as needed including grocery shopping
- Coordinate vehicle maintenance, keeping track of licensing, insurance and warranties.
- Provide care for the client's dog (feed, walk, groomers, vet appointments, etc.)
- Be knowledgeable in flower arranging, table setting, and formal service
- Resolve difficulties with staff or vendors in a stress-free manner
- Provide light to regular housekeeping
- Understand the proper techniques and tools necessary to care for fine arts, antiques, fine china, silver, etc.
- Provide light to regular laundry and ironing service, wardrobe and closet organizing, and proper care of fine linens
- Provide regular meal preparation for the Principal
- Act as chauffeur and drive the principal and his dog if needed
- Research, vet and negotiate, schedule, and supervise all vendors, contractors, and subcontractors
- Maintain the household budget, negotiate and approve all vendors’ invoices
- Maintain accounting for household checking, credit/debit cards, and petty cash
- Make travel arrangements and assist with guest accommodations
- Maintain records for projects, vendors, purchases, vehicles, and repairs
- Develop a household manual for the residence with yearly schedules for all household maintenance items, vendor contracts, emergency numbers, etc.
- Create an inventory of all food items, household products, and order and purchase items as needed
- Create an inventory of all crystal, silver, fine art, and other items as requested
- Greet guests, answer the phone, and handle correspondence
- Conduct Internet research and product ordering as necessary
- Offer basic computer knowledge, including QuickBooks
- Be technically savvy with smart-home systems, update smart technology
